Career path
Occupational Health and Safety Manager
Oversee the implementation of health and safety policies and procedures in a workplace. Ensure compliance with relevant laws and regulations. Develop and manage budgets for health and safety initiatives.
Health and Safety Consultant
Provide expert advice on health and safety matters to organizations. Conduct risk assessments and develop strategies to mitigate risks. Implement health and safety management systems.
Risk Manager
Identify and assess potential risks to an organization. Develop and implement strategies to mitigate risks. Monitor and review risk management plans.
Health and Safety Advisor
Provide guidance and advice on health and safety matters to employees. Develop and implement health and safety training programs. Conduct health and safety audits.
Environmental Health Officer
Enforce environmental health regulations and standards. Conduct inspections and investigations. Develop and implement environmental health policies.
Safety Inspector
Conduct inspections and investigations to identify potential safety hazards. Develop and implement safety procedures and protocols. Monitor and review safety performance.
Occupational Psychologist
Apply psychological principles to improve workplace health and safety. Conduct research and develop evidence-based interventions. Provide expert advice on workplace well-being.
Workplace Health and Safety Specialist
Develop and implement health and safety strategies and initiatives. Conduct risk assessments and develop mitigation plans. Monitor and review health and safety performance.
Health and Safety Engineer
Design and implement health and safety systems and procedures. Conduct risk assessments and develop mitigation plans. Monitor and review health and safety performance.
Health and Safety Auditor
Conduct audits to assess the effectiveness of health and safety management systems. Identify areas for improvement and develop recommendations for improvement.
Learn keyfacts about NVQ Level 6 Occupational Health Safety Course
The NVQ Level 6 Occupational Health and Safety Course is a comprehensive training program designed for senior health and safety professionals, managers, and directors in various industries.
Learning outcomes of this course include developing strategic health and safety management systems, leading health and safety teams, and implementing effective risk management practices.
The duration of the NVQ Level 6 Occupational Health and Safety Course typically ranges from 12 to 18 months, depending on the individual's prior experience and the number of assessment units required.
Industry relevance is a key aspect of this course, as it provides learners with the knowledge and skills to apply health and safety regulations, standards, and best practices in their respective sectors.
Occupational health and safety professionals can benefit from this course by enhancing their expertise in areas such as health and safety policy development, risk assessment and mitigation, and health and safety auditing.
The NVQ Level 6 Occupational Health and Safety Course is suitable for learners who have prior experience in health and safety management and are looking to advance their careers or take on senior roles.
Upon completion of the course, learners can demonstrate their competence in occupational health and safety management and progress to senior roles or start their own health and safety consulting businesses.
